Lasveguix not only paints, he tears, layers, and reconstructs. His creations are skin-like walls, fragments of urbanity where posters mingle with graffiti, where acrylic dialogues with spray paint and Posca. Each piece is a pulse, a street scar transposed onto canvas.
Introduced to graffiti by his cousin SUOZ, he nourishes his visual language with the walls of Paris and London. In his gesture, you can hear the echoes of the great names that marked urban and contemporary art: Jacques Villeglé and Raymond Hains for torn-poster art, Vhils for sculpted matter, Basquiat for raw energy, Jérôme Mesnager for the silhouette, Miss Tic for the poetry of words, Ernest Pignon-Ernest for urban memory, Jef Aérosol for stencils, Invader for the urban pixel, Obey for the engaged icon.
Active in the street art scene for over twenty years, Lasveguix has established a universe that is at once punk and poetic. Since 2022, he has translated this street heritage into the studio, creating works where movement, time and collective memory freeze without ever fading.
Known for his singularity, he regularly takes part in charitable galas and prestigious auctions — COEUR CENTRAL at Roland Garros, Around the Williams at Pavillon Ledoyen, Faire ma part, Nav Solidaire, or SOS Préma. His creations reach record-breaking sums there, confirming a unique place in urban and contemporary art.
Lasveguix advocates accessible, free, and vibrant art, where every torn piece tells a story of love and positivity.
